Blood Pressure Cuff
Prototyping 101
In this class, I was tasked with taking apart a blood pressure cuff and reconstructing it using prototyping techniques. I started with sketching and went through all the steps of prototyping from creative thinking, modeling, and building to achieving a final reconstructed blood pressure cuff.
